Wood window service encompasses a variety of solutions aimed at maintaining, restoring, and enhancing the functionality and appearance of wooden window frames. These services often include repairs to address issues such as rotting wood, cracked or broken panes, and deteriorated sashes. Additionally, professionals may offer refinishing and repainting to improve the aesthetic appeal and provide protective coatings that help extend the lifespan of wood windows. Proper maintenance and timely repairs can prevent further damage, ensuring that windows continue to serve their purpose effectively.

One of the primary problems that wood window services help resolve is wood decay caused by moisture intrusion. Over time, exposure to rain, humidity, and temperature fluctuations can lead to rot, warping, and insect damage. These issues can compromise the structural integrity of the window and reduce energy efficiency. Services may also include replacing damaged components, sealing gaps, and installing weatherstripping to improve insulation and prevent drafts. Addressing these problems helps preserve the window’s functionality and can contribute to energy savings within the property.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Woodland Hills,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Replacement Costs - Replacing a wood window typ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size and style. For example, a standard double-hung window may cost around $500 to $700 to replace. Costs can vary based on the window's complexity and local labor rates.

Repair Expenses - Repairing wood windows generally falls between $150 and $600 per window. Common repairs include fixing rotted wood or broken hardware, with minor fixes on the lower end and extensive repairs approaching the higher range. The overall cost depends on the extent of damage and required materials.

Refinishing and Restoration - Restoring the finish on a wood window can cost between $200 and $800 per window. This includes stripping old paint or stain, sanding, and applying new finishes. The price varies based on the window's size and condition.

Additional Service Fees - Extra costs may apply for services such as custom modifications or hardware upgrades, typically ranging from $100 to $400 per window. These fees depend on the specific work requested and the complexity involved.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
